nitrogen | has reserves × 10 tonnes |  |
has mineral nitratine, nitrammite, nitrobarite, nitrocalcite and nitromagnesite |  |
has neutron scattering length 0.936 × 10-12 cm |  |
has electron affinity -7 kJ mol-1 from N to N- |  |
has toxic intake non-toxic as N2 gas but NO2, HCN and NH3 are toxic |  |
has mass magnetic susceptibility -5.4 × 10-9 kg-1 m3 for gas |  |
has van der Waals radii 154 pm |  |
has covalent radii 70 pm for single bond |  |
has thermal neutron capture cross section 1.91 barns |  |
has longest lived isotope nitrogen 14 |  |
has isotope mass range 12 to 18 |  |
has number of isotopes 8 including nuclear isomers |  |
has pronunciation niy-troh-jen |  |
has name origin nitron genes = nitre forming (potassium nitrate) from Greek |  |
has discovery location Edinburgh, Scotland, UK |  |
has abundance 8.71 × 107 in Sun relative to H = 1 × 1012 |  |
has abundance 25 p.p.m. in Earth's crust |  |
has abundance 780900 p.p.m. by volume in Earth's atmosphere |  |
has abundance p.p.m. in seawater |  |
has specimen small pressurized canisters. Safe. |  |
has world production 44 × 106 tonnes year-1 |  |
has chief source liquified air |  |
has mass absorption coefficient 7.52 cm2 g-1 for CuKα X-ray diffraction |  |
has mass absorption coefficient 0.916 cm2 g-1 for MoKα X-ray diffraction |  |

has term symbol 4S3/2 in ground state |  |
has electron configuration [He]2s22p3 in ground state |  |
has mass of element in person 1.8 kg for a 70 kg average person |  |
has daily dietary intake high |  |
has level in humans 34300 mg dm-3 in blood |  |
has level in humans 43000 p.p.m. in bone |  |
has level in humans 72000 p.p.m. in liver |  |
has level in humans 72000 p.p.m. in muscle |  |
has hazard harmless gas, but it could asphyxiate if it excluded oxygen from the lungs |  |
has biological role constituent element of DNA and amino acids; nitrogen cycle in nature |  |
has thermal conductivity 0.02598 W m-1 K-1 at 300 K for gas |  |
has molar volume 12.65 cm3 |  |
has heat capacity 29.125 J K-1 mol-1 for molecular gas (N2) at constant pressure 0.1 MPa at 298.15 K |  |
has heat capacity 20.786 J K-1 mol-1 for atomic gas at constant pressure 0.1 MPa at 298.15 K |  |
has heat of vaporization 5.577 kJ mol-1 |  |
has heat of fusion 0.720 kJ mol-1 |  |
has boiling point 77.4 K |  |
has melting point 63.29 K |  |
has electronegativity 3.04 Pauling |  |
has relative atomic mass 14.00674 in units of 12C = 12.000 |  |
has atomic radii 71 pm |  |
has number of protons 7 |  |
has registry number 7727-37-9 for Chemical Abstracts System database |  |
has density 1026 kg m-3 for solid at 21 K |  |
has density 880 kg m-3 for liquid at 77.4 K boiling point |  |
has density 1.2506 kg m-3 for gas at 273 K |  |
has synthesis mechanism liquifaction of air |  |
has ocean oxidation state V |  |
has ocean residence time 6000 years |  |
has atomic number 7 |  |
reacts with generaly unreactive at normal temperatures |  |
has discovery date 1772 |  |
has discoverer D. Rutherford |  |
has uses fertilizers, acids (HNO3), explosives, plastics and dyes |  |
has image  |  |
has critical pressure 3394 kPa |  |
has critical temperature 126.05 K |  |
